人机交互方法及装置与流程
- 国知局
- 2024-06-21 11:29:46
本发明涉及人机交互领域,具体涉及一种人机交互方法及装置。
背景技术:
1、虚拟助手是一种基于人工智能技术的智能系统,其能够与人类进行语言对话和交互。然而,现有的虚拟助手在提供语音交互时,通常是先将交互对象的对话内容转换为文本数据,再根据所述文本数据向交互对象提供相应语音交互,这种语音交互的提供方式只能针对交互对象的对话内容进行简单地答复,使得人机交互体验较差。
技术实现思路
1、有鉴于此,本发明实施例提供了一种人机交互方法及装置,以使虚拟助手向交互对象提供与交互对象的当前情绪状态和虚拟助手当前人物设定的语言风格相匹配的语音交互内容,从而改善人机交互体验。
2、第一方面,本发明实施例提供了一种人机交互方法,适用于虚拟助手,所述方法包括:
3、采集交互对象的语音数据;
4、根据所述语音数据确定所述交互对象的当前情绪状态;
5、至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气;
6、根据所述交互文本和交互语气向所述交互对象提供语音交互。
7、进一步地,根据所述语音数据确定所述交互对象的当前情绪状态包括:
8、将所述语音数据转换为文本数据并提取所述文本数据中的文本特征;
9、提取所述语音数据中的音频特征;
10、根据所述音频特征和\或所述文本特征确定所述当前情绪状态。
11、进一步地,至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气包括:
12、根据所述当前情绪状态、虚拟助手当前人物设定的语音风格和虚拟助手的当前属性参数确定所述交互文本和所述交互语气。
13、进一步地,根据所述交互文本和交互语气向所述交互对象提供语音交互包括:
14、根据所述交互语气将所述交互文本转换为交互语音;
15、输出所述交互语音。
16、进一步地,所述方法还包括:
17、响应于检测到与所述交互对象的交互操作或检测到所述交互对象的虚拟物品赠予操作,对所述虚拟助手的当前属性参数进行更新。
18、进一步地,在根据所述交互文本和交互语气向所述交互对象提供语音交互时,所述方法还包括:
19、控制人机交互界面中的虚拟助手形象做出与当前所提供语音交互内容相匹配的肢体动作和表情。
20、进一步地,在采集交互对象的语音数据之前,所述方法还包括:
21、响应于检测到任意预设交互条件被满足,主动向交互对象提供与当前被满足预设交互条件相匹配的语音交互内容。
22、第二方面,本发明实施例提供了一种人机交互装置,所述装置包括:
23、采集单元,用于采集交互对象的语音数据;
24、情绪确定单元,用于根据所述语音数据确定所述交互对象的当前情绪状态;
25、交互确定单元,用于至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气;
26、语音提供单元,用于根据所述交互文本和交互语气向所述交互对象提供语音交互。
27、第三方面,本发明实施例提供了一种计算机可读存储介质,其上存储计算机程序指令,所述计算机程序指令在被处理器执行时实现如第一方面中任一项所述的方法。
28、第四方面,本发明实施例提供了一种电子设备,所述设备包括:
29、存储器,用于存储一条或多条计算机程序指令;
30、处理器,所述一条或多条计算机程序指令被所述处理器执行以实现如第一方面中任一项所述的方法。
31、本发明实施例的人机交互方法会采集交互对象的语音数据,并根据所述语音数据确定出交互对象的当前情绪状态,再至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气,进而根据所述交互文本和交互语气向所述交互对象提供语音交互。由此,通过至少基于交互对象的当前情绪状态和虚拟助手当前人物设定的语言风格来确定交互文本和交互语气,本发明实施例可以使虚拟助手向交互对象提供与交互对象的当前情绪状态和虚拟助手当前人物设定的语言风格相匹配的语音交互内容,从而改善人机交互体验。
技术特征:1.一种人机交互方法,适用于虚拟助手,其特征在于,所述方法包括:
2.根据权利要求1所述的方法,其特征在于,根据所述语音数据确定所述交互对象的当前情绪状态包括:
3.根据权利要求1所述的方法,其特征在于,至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气包括:
4.根据权利要求1所述的方法,其特征在于,根据所述交互文本和交互语气向所述交互对象提供语音交互包括:
5.根据权利要求3所述的方法,其特征在于,所述方法还包括:
6.根据权利要求1所述的方法,其特征在于,在根据所述交互文本和交互语气向所述交互对象提供语音交互时,所述方法还包括:
7.根据权利要求1所述的方法,其特征在于,在采集交互对象的语音数据之前,所述方法还包括:
8.一种人机交互装置,其特征在于,所述装置包括:
9.一种计算机可读存储介质,其上存储计算机程序指令,其特征在于,所述计算机程序指令在被处理器执行时实现如权利要求1-7中任一项所述的方法。
10.一种电子设备,其特征在于,所述设备包括:
技术总结本发明实施例公开了一种人机交互方法及装置。本发明实施例的人机交互方法会采集交互对象的语音数据,并根据所述语音数据确定出交互对象的当前情绪状态,再至少基于所述当前情绪状态和虚拟助手当前人物设定的语言风格确定交互文本和交互语气,进而根据所述交互文本和交互语气向所述交互对象提供语音交互。由此,通过至少基于交互对象的当前情绪状态和虚拟助手当前人物设定的语言风格来确定交互文本和交互语气,本发明实施例可以使虚拟助手向交互对象提供与交互对象的当前情绪状态和虚拟助手当前人物设定的语言风格相匹配的语音交互内容,从而改善人机交互体验。技术研发人员:刘斌新,王碧豪,李元嵩受保护的技术使用者:北京心影随形科技有限公司技术研发日:技术公布日:2024/2/21本文地址:https://www.jishuxx.com/zhuanli/20240618/21845.html
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 YYfuon@163.com 举报,一经查实,本站将立刻删除。